Mar 4, 2020 · 2. Locate and expand Human Interface Devices. 3. Expand Human Interface Devices. 4. Right-click on HID-Compliant Touch Screen and select Uninstall. If there is more than one driver, uninstall those as well. 5. Right-click on Intel (R) Precise Touch Device and select Uninstall.

Reset touch calibration to the default settings. 1. In the search box on the taskbar, enter calibrate, and then select Calibrate the screen for pen or touch input from the list of results. (With a mouse, select Start , then select Calibrate the screen for pen or touch input .) 2.Press Tab until you select Reset, and then press Enter .

Exit then restart.Make sure to replace the F16 fuse with a hard-coated fuse (not soft coated as the original). The hard-coated fuse leads heat better and dissipates to the surroundings as required. Part number is N 01713125 as listed in the NHTSA recall. My VW Golf cab from 2016 has developed an issue with the media unit. On some screens the bottom left hand corner in particular is not responsive to touch. No all screens suffer this problem. For example I can select the New Destination button in bottom left hand corner of default Nav screen but when I ...1.
